Crystal structure of tungsten cofactor synthesizing protein MoaB from Pyrococcus furiosus
Template:ABSTRACT PUBMED 24465852
Function
[MOAB_PYRFU] Catalyzes the adenylation of molybdopterin as part of the biosynthesis of the molybdenum-cofactor.
About this Structure
4lhb is a 3 chain structure with sequence from Pyrfu. Full crystallographic information is available from OCA.
